Explanation
Background: The City of Columbus, Ohio, holds title to a sewer easement, located on that real property commonly known as Bishop Watterson High School, by virtue of a recorded deed of easement in D.B. 1161, Pg. 213, Franklin County Recorder's Office, Ohio. Frederick F. Campbell, successor to James A. Griffin, successor to Edward J. Herrmann, Bishop of the Roman Catholic Diocese of Columbus, has submitted plans to the City that require the partial removal of the existing sewer, and has requested that said recorded deed of easement be released, in part, as more particularly described within the body of this legislation. The Department of Public Service, has determined that the partial release of said deed of easement will not adversely affect the City of Columbus and therefore should be granted. The following legislation authorizes the Director of the Department of Public Utilities to execute those instruments necessary to release a portion of the aforementioned sewer easement more fully described in the body of this legislation.
